6 Stimmen

Gibt es unter Windows eine Schnittstelle zum Kopieren von Ordnern?

Ich möchte den Ordner A kopieren und auf dem Desktop einfügen.

Ich verwende derzeit C++, also vorzugsweise eine OO-Schnittstelle, wenn verfügbar.

-1voto

2371 Punkte 947

Hier ist ein Beispiel, das SHFileOperation verwendet:

http://msdn.microsoft.com/en-us/library/bb776887%28VS.85%29.aspx#example

Hier ist ein schneller Hack ohne sie:

#import <stdlib.h>

int main(int argc, char *argv[]) {

    system("robocopy \"C:\\my\\folder\" \"%userprofile%\\desktop\\\" /MIR");
    return 0;
}

-1voto

Elmi Ahmadov Punkte 1021

Es funktioniert

#include <iostream>

int main()
{
    system("xcopy C:\\Users\\Elmi\\Desktop\\AAAAAA\ C:\\Users\\Elmi\\Desktop\\b\ /e /i /h");
    return 0;
}

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X